Projeto de Sistemas Digitais FPGA

Disponível somente no TrabalhosFeitos
  • Páginas : 4 (863 palavras )
  • Download(s) : 0
  • Publicado : 17 de março de 2014
Ler documento completo
Amostra do texto
COMUNICAÇÃO DE UM TECLADO PS2
COM FPGA

RESUMO
Neste relatório é mostrado como foi possível criar um editor de
texto rudimentar no display de LCD, com entrada de dados via tecladocom saídaPS2utilizando o FPGA da Altera Cyclone II. Os dados são
fornecidos na forma serial pelo teclado e são convertidos pelo FPGA
para a forma paralela onde são dados como entradas do display de
LCD.
1.INTRODUÇÃO
Os displays de LCD são dispositivos eletrônicos úteis para diversos sistemas integrados, e encontrados facilmente em eletrônicas por
todo o país em diversos formatos. Já são fabricados sobreuma placa
de circuito impresso com memória pré-programada proporcionando
uma comunicação num nível um pouco mais elevado, visto que o host
não precisa se preocupar com fatores como a multiplexaçãodo display, os tipos de caracteres e várias outras funções, embutidas agora
em diversos códigos de comando de 8 bits. Pode ser usada como letreiro, interface para troca de informação, interface decomandos gerais associado a qualquer outro sistema digital. Uma vez ajustado o
protocolo de comunicação, o display poderá ser acoplado a todos esses sistemas e é justamente esse o objetivo do projeto,conseguir
ajustar o protocolo de comunicação do display com um teclado PS/2,
que é também facilmente encontrado.
2. OBJETIVOS
2.1 OBJETIVOS GERAIS
Aplicar os conceitos aprendidos em sala de aulasobre a utilização da linguagem Verilog HDL (do inglês - Hardware Description Language) na implementação de sistemas digitais utilizando o Kit da Altera Cyclone II EP2C35F672C6.
2.2 OBJETIVOSESPECÍFICOS
Entender e utilizar os protocolos tanto da entrada PS2 quanto
do displayLCD.
Permitir uma comunicação coesa do teclado PS2 com o display
LCD16x2.

Verilog:
Verilog é uma linguagem dedescrição de hardware usada para
modelar sistemas eletrônicos. Esta ferramenta suporta o design, verificação e implementação de projetos analógicos, digitais e circuito
híbridos em vários níveis de...